PGTI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2014 in Review

142 of the 3,480 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in PGT, Inc. (PGTI) for Q2 2014, worth a combined $347M — down 26% from $466M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 38 funds opened new PGTI positions and 33 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 59 added to existing stakes and 34 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Columbia Wanger Asset Management, adding an estimated $14.4M. The largest seller was Pictet Asset Management (UK), exiting entirely with an estimated $9.48M sold.
